This study investigated the association between destructive leadership and turnover intention, as well as the mediating function of ego depletion and the moderating role of kindergarten affiliation, based on social exchange … WebFeb 13, 2024 · In general, naturalization was a two-step process that took a minimum of five years. After residing in the United States for two years, an alien could file a "Declaration of Intention" ("first papers") to become a citizen. After three additional years, the alien could then "Petition for Naturalization" (”second papers”).

Declarations of Intention (also known as first papers) document the first step in the citizenship process. In format, the declaration consists of an oath asserting the alien's intent to become a citizen, to support the constitution, and to renounce foreign allegiance and hereditary titles.
